After an incredible comeback, WNBA star Brittney Griner has bravely decided to skip the Phoenix Mercury’s two-game road trip to Chicago and Indiana. Griner made the decision, citing concerns about her mental health. This decision received overwhelming support from both her team and the WNBA community.

Stephen A. Smith offers his support to Griner

During a recent episode of his show, Smith talked about Griner’s decision to step back. He found it to be a valid action, considering all that Griner’s been through.

He said, “She was a political tool that Vladimir Putin and the Russian government used at that time because obviously, the United States has been assisting Ukraine in terms of sending them weapons and things of that nature. And obviously Russia wanted to be hardcore about that and so they imprisoned her.”


He pointed out that in order to release Griner, the United States had to release an arms dealer prisoner labeled “The Merchant of Death.” And many harbor resentment towards her as this prisoner had his release from jail for hers. Furthermore, she also didn’t stand up for the national anthem amidst the George Floyd protests.

He continued, “Nevertheless, she’s going through a lot. It is very, very understandable. And because of that, she needs a mental break”
